High-Risk Travelers

Travelers visiting friends and relatives in malaria-endemic regions face increased risk due to waning immunity. Military personnel and pregnant women are also high-risk categories due to prolonged exposure and health vulnerabilities. Understanding these factors is crucial for taking preventive measures.

Geographical and Environmental Factors

The risk of malaria is higher in tropical and subtropical regions like sub-Saharan Africa. Environmental factors such as staying in unscreened accommodations and traveling during the rainy season increase exposure to mosquitoes. Planning your trips with these considerations in mind can help mitigate risks.
